This came out when I was a child, so the college experience went right over my head. As an adult, I have garnered a greater appreciation for this cinematic masterpiece. While some of the problems didn't ring a bell with me (aka the dorm and fraternity experiences), there were a lot of issues that hit home. It is astounding that 19 years later, these problems are still alive and well in the collegiate system. Especially violence, racism, and sniper shootings/gun-related tragedies. The great theme of awakening and changing as a young adult should be a theme we can all agree upon. As presented in the movie, these changes send us in all different directions, fueled on different ideologies. I have seen this masterpiece a few times, but only in parts. Having the time to sit down and analyze it for a class has given me a greater appreciation.
